#!/usr/local/bin/bash
#+--------------------------------------+
#| Here, we get the databases list, |
#| using the SHOW DATABASES query |
#| and backup all 064* named DATABASES |
#| to the BACKUP/DATE |
#+--------------------------------------+
DATE=`date "+%d.%m.%Y"`
BACKUP=/usr/local/www/db_backup/
NOWDIR=$BACKUP/$DATE
DATABASES=`echo "show databases;" | mysql --password=***** \
--user=***** | awk '/064/ {print}'`
# ----- Create NOWDIR -----
# if not exists
if [ ! -e "$NOWDIR" ] ;
then mkdir $NOWDIR
fi
#----- DUMPING -------
# dumping all 064 named
# DATABASES
for i in $DATABASES
do
mysqldump $i --opt \
--password=***** \
--user=***** | gzip -c > "$NOWDIR/$i($DATE).gz"
done
==================================
Вот такой скрипт(из /etc/periodic/daily),
по идее должен бэкапить
базы данных 064* , но в папке с бэкапом
не набдюдаются архивы с дампами, почему ?
Если запускаю скрипт сам, то вроде все бэкапится,
в чем трабла.
OS : FreeBSD
Ответ на:
комментарий
от anonymous
Ответ на:
комментарий
от Obidos
Ответ на:
комментарий
от anonymous
Ответ на:
комментарий
от anonymous
Ответ на:
комментарий
от anonymous
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.
Похожие темы
- Форум Помогите реализовать шифрование файла (2012)
- Форум проверка выполнение скрипта на ошибки (2019)
- Форум Бэкап mysql, mysldump -A бэкапит не все базы. (2012)
- Форум Резервное копирование mysql (2011)
- Форум настройка mysql (2006)
- Форум При бэкапе БД увеличивается значение Temporary tables created on disk. Так и должно быть? (2015)
- Форум Как присвоить файлу дату создания? (2012)
- Форум mysqldump не работает из крона (2012)
- Форум Бэкапы...быкапы (2012)
- Форум Бэкап. Ротация. (2010)